AHA Associate Podcast Series | Siemens Healthineers

In this episode, Kathleen Wessel is joined by Francois Nolte, Global Lead for Networked Care at Siemens Healthineers, and Andrew Menard, Executive Director of Radiology Strategy and Innovation at Johns Hopkins. Francois and Andrew share insights on decentralized imaging services and their impact on the sustainability of health care systems. Efficiently deployed imaging capabilities in nonacute settings can help clinicians diagnose and treat medical conditions earlier, ultimately improving clinical outcomes for patients and business outcomes for providers.

Researchers receive $1.5 million nurse suicide prevention grant

The American Foundation for Suicide Prevention awarded a three-year, $1.5 million nurse suicide prevention grant to nurse researchers at the University of California San Diego, Ohio State University and the American Nurses Association.

AHA Disparities Toolkit

The Health Research and Educational Trust Disparities Toolkit is a Web-based tool that provides hospitals, health systems, clinics, and health plans information and resources for systematically collecting race, ethnicity, and primary language data from patients.
